Derry City, Northern Ireland, drew 6,000 worshippers for a Eucharistic procession that ended beneath its historic walls, launching what organizers called the first coordinated global Marian procession across six continents. The synchronized event, spanning more than 550 parishes and 15 major shrines, signals a bold show of Catholic unity and could sharpen the movement’s worldwide reach. Faith without borders.
